The Flag Point Track Site contains approximately 35 dinosaur footprints with an average length of about 18 inches. The prints are very clear and seem to be well preserved. There is a striking pictograph of a print on the vertical rock face below the main track site.

The red pictograph of the footprint is in the central part of a rock art panel. It is surrounded by figures on both sides facing the footprint with arms raised, as though worshiping the print. The pictograph is the oldest known recording of a dinosaur footprint in North America. The pictograph is thought to date from 900-1150 A.D.
